Etymology[edit]
From Mandarin 肅慎/肃慎 (Sùshèn) which ultimately came from Old Chinese 肅慎 (OC *sɯwɢ djins).

Proper noun[edit]
Sushen
- An ancient ethnic group of people who lived in the northeastern part of China during the Zhou dynasty.
